Rugby Club Seeks University Permission For Pacific Trip

But Big Three Composite Team Instead May Meet Stanford in Spring

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

Permission from University authorities to play a game with Stanford on the Coast this spring is being sought by the Harvard Rugby Club, it was revealed yesterday. The Club has received an invitation for a contest to be played during Easter vacation.

In the event that the Harvard booters are not authorized to make the trip, it is understood that a combined Big Three team, comprising eligible Harvard, Yale, and Princeton players will make the journey westward. Last year a combination fifteen representing the three colleges played a visiting team from Cambridge University, England.
